A crew of adventurers will take to the high seas on a decade-long mission inspired by explorer Jacques Cousteau to examine the world's most important underwater treasures. Swiss-based marine conservation group the Antinea Foundation, behind the project, will connect their old-fashioned adventure to a modern audience via the Internet in a bid to boost interest in the seas.
